Are you wondering if you can start an HSA without your employer? The answer is a resounding yes! While many people are familiar with HSAs offered through their workplace, it is entirely possible to open and contribute to an HSA on your own, even if your employer doesn't offer one.
Individual HSA accounts are a great way to save for medical expenses tax-free, regardless of your employment status. Here’s a comprehensive guide to help you understand how you can start an HSA on your own:
With the rising costs of healthcare, having an HSA can provide you with a valuable financial safety net for current and future medical expenses. By starting an HSA on your own, you have full control over your contributions and can benefit from the tax advantages that come with it.
